Land Surveyor Calibration (Auto)
Calibration is as described earlier in this manual, with one exception: the %
GAS [%HI] sensor is calibrated separately from the Catalytic (PPM/%LEL
or PPM/%LO) sensor. Therefore a multi-step calibration process has been
programmed into the Auto Calibration routine. First, the standard sensors are
calibrated using a multi-gas mixture. Then TC sensor is calibrated using a
multi-gas cylinder, containing 50% CH
4
(Methane), CO
2
(Carbon Dioxide),
and N
2
(Nitrogen).
1. A separate air adjust is required for the % LEL and % GAS ranges.
Perform an air adjust in the % LEL and % GAS ranges before
calibration.
2. Begin the calibration process by performing an Auto Calibration. The
TC sensor will be ignored during the multi-gas calibration.
3. When the multi-gas Auto Calibration is complete, a double beep
prompts the user to begin the TC sensor calibration. The default gas
concentration is displayed with the ADJ icon to indicate you may
change the concentration. If the concentration on the gas cylinder
does not match the concentration displayed.
4. Press to begin the calibration.
5. Apply the calibration gas and follow the prompt to complete the
calibration process.
